If you are on "extras" benefits from your health fund, they will pay you back anything over what the PBS amount is


 


eg I think its currently about $36. So if a prescription medication costs say $40 - they will give you $4 back. If it costs $80, they will give you $44 back

Pharmacist Error Hospitalizes 7-Year-Old Boy Due to Wrong Drug


 


A 7-year-old New York boy was given the wrong medication by his local pharmacy, which caused him to be hospitalized and treated for a methadone overdose. Little Adrien Torres was unconscious after taking his prescription and rushed to the hospital for treatment.


 


According to Christina Torres, the boyโ€™s mother, she had Felicity Pharmacy in the Bronx fill Adrienโ€™s prescription for generic Ritalin. After she had given her son his third dose of medication, he went limp, stopped breathing, his eyes were rolling back in his head and he looked blue.
